

He was born August 17, 1953, in Smithers to Bob and Irene Phillips. He grew up in Telkwa before moving to Prince George to attend the College of New Caledonia where he studied Geography. Alan then went on to get his Master’s degree at the University of Victoria.
Alan was a proud father, and in 1995 he married Terry Phillips and they shared 30 wonderful years together. Alan is survived by his wife Terry, his family Colin, Crystal, Richard and Stephanie as well as grandchildren Nicholas, Olivia, Daniel and Steven.
Alan spent much of his career working for the Ministry of Environment before moving to the Ministry of Labour. He enjoyed lifelong friendships he developed with coworkers and classmates. Outside of work he loved to fish, ride his motorcycle, woodwork and watch his grandchildren play.
Alan was deeply loved by his family and he will be sorely missed.
